The Evolution of Cyber Threats and the Need for Advanced Defensive Postures

Historically, cybersecurity defenses relied heavily on signature-based detection and perimeter security. However, as threat actors adopt advanced tactics—such as fileless attacks, supply chain compromises, and AI-driven social engineering—the industry has shifted focus towards proactive, intelligence-driven defenses.

Recent industry reports highlight a doubling in endpoint attacks over the past year, underscoring the urgency of integrating intelligent threat detection systems. Key Principles of Modern Cyber Defense

  • Proactive Threat Hunting: Moving beyond reactive incident response to actively seek out adversaries within networks before damage occurs.
  • Behavioral Analytics: Utilizing machine learning to identify anomalous activities that deviate from baseline behaviors.
  • Zero Trust Architectures: Implementing verification at every access point, regardless of location.
  • Information Sharing and Collaboration: Engaging in industry-wide threat intelligence sharing to stay ahead of emerging threats.
